Sleep on your side

One of the most effective ways to reduce snoring is by sleeping on your side. When you sleep on your back, gravity pulls down the soft tissues in your throat, which can obstruct airflow and cause snoring. Sleeping on your side helps to keep these tissues from collapsing into your airway.

If you’re not used to sleeping on your side, it may take some time to get comfortable in this position. One trick that often works is putting a body pillow behind you so that you don’t roll onto your back during the night.

It’s also essential to practice good sleep hygiene when sleeping on your side. This means finding a comfortable mattress and pillows that support proper alignment of the spine while taking pressure off other parts of the body such as shoulders and hips.

Use a humidifier

Using a humidifier can be an effective home remedy to alleviate snoring. Dry air can cause irritation in the throat and nasal passages, leading to snoring. Adding moisture to the air with a humidifier can help reduce this irritation and promote better breathing.

When choosing a humidifier, it’s important to consider the size of your room as well as any other specific needs you may have such as allergies or asthma. It’s recommended to use distilled water in the humidifier rather than tap water, which may contain minerals that could lead to respiratory problems.

Using essential oils in combination with your humidifier can also enhance its effectiveness for reducing snoring. Eucalyptus oil is known for its anti-inflammatory properties and peppermint oil has been shown to relieve congestion.

However, it’s important not to overdo it with the humidity level as too much moisture in the air can actually worsen snoring by causing congestion and increasing discomfort during sleep. Aim for a humidity level between 30-50% for optimal results.

Exercise regularly

Regular exercise is not only good for your overall wellhealthorganic.com:if-you-are-troubled-by-snoring-then-know-home-remedies-to-deal-with-snoring health, but it can also help reduce snoring. When you’re physically active, you tone the muscles in your body, including those in your throat and neck region that contribute to snoring.

Aerobic exercises such as running, swimming or cycling can help improve lung capacity and strengthen these muscles. You don’t need to engage in high-intensity workouts; even low-impact activities like walking for 30 minutes a day can make a significant difference.

Yoga is another excellent option as it focuses on deep breathing techniques that open up airways and reduce congestion. Certain yoga poses like the Cobra pose or the Fish pose may be especially effective at reducing snoring.
